Solution for What is 5615 increased by 33 percent? (5615 plus 33%):

5615 + (33/100 * 5615) = 7467.95

Now we have: 5615 increased by 33 percent = 7467.95

Question: What is 5615 increased by 33 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 5615.

Step 2: We have b with value of 33.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 5615 + (\frac{33}{100} * 5615).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{7467.95}

Therefore, {5615} increased by {33\%} is {7467.95}
